When picking energy-saving windows, consider the following key features:
1. Low-Emission (Low-E) Glass
Low-E glass has an unique finishing that reflects heat back into the [Home Improvement](https://hinton-kragelund-2.thoughtlanes.net/10-things-people-get-wrong-about-the-word-window-upgrade) throughout winter and obstructs solar heat during summer season. This increases energy effectiveness throughout the year.
2. Argon/Krypton Gas Fills
These inert gases are utilized in between panes of glass to lower heat transfer. Argon is more common, while krypton provides even much better insulation but is usually more costly.
3. Spacer Bars
These are the products used in between glass panes. Warm-edge spacers lower heat transfer and condensation.
4. U-Value and Solar Heat Gain Coefficient (SHGC)U-Value steps how well a window insulates. The lower the U-value, the better the insulation, with worths typically varying from 0.15 to 1.20.SHGC steps the amount of solar radiation that gets in through the [Window Insulation](https://hedge.fachschaft.informatik.uni-kl.de/s/AkXfHHOmoB).
